Abstract

Abrasive jet machining is an effective machining process for processing a variety of Hard and Brittle Material. And has various distinct advantages over the other non-traditional cutting technologies, such as, high machining versatility, minimum stresses on the work piece, high flexibility no thermal distortion, and small cutting forces. This paper presents an extensive review of the current state of research and development tin the abrasive jet machining process by using alternate abrasive particles (waste bur particles) further challenges and scope of future development in abrasive jet machining are also projected.
